From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!.POSTED!not-for-mail From: "Mike Gran" Newsgroups: gmane.lisp.guile.user Subject: My Lisp Game Jam entry Date: Mon, 30 Apr 2018 08:13:09 -0700 Message-ID: <20180430151309.GA10598@joshua.dnsalias.com> NNTP-Posting-Host: blaine.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Trace: blaine.gmane.org 1525101105 13110 195.159.176.226 (30 Apr 2018 15:11:45 GMT) X-Complaints-To: usenet@blaine.gmane.org NNTP-Posting-Date: Mon, 30 Apr 2018 15:11:45 +0000 (UTC) User-Agent: Mutt/1.9.2 (2017-12-15) To: guile-user@gnu.org Original-X-From: guile-user-bounces+guile-user=m.gmane.org@gnu.org Mon Apr 30 17:11:41 2018 Return-path: Envelope-to: guile-user@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by blaine.gmane.org with esmtp (Exim 4.84_2) (envelope-from ) id 1fDASq-0003Gq-0b for guile-user@m.gmane.org; Mon, 30 Apr 2018 17:11:40 +0200 Original-Received: from localhost ([::1]:60169 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1fDAUw-00014i-PH for guile-user@m.gmane.org; Mon, 30 Apr 2018 11:13:50 -0400 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:60282)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1fDAUQ-000138-Qt for guile-user@gnu.org; Mon, 30 Apr 2018 11:13:19 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1fDAUN-0007p2-Gk for guile-user@gnu.org; Mon, 30 Apr 2018 11:13:18 -0400 Original-Received: from sonic301-3.consmr.mail.bf2.yahoo.com ([74.6.129.42]:38875) by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_128_CBC_SHA1:16) (Exim 4.71) (envelope-from ) id 1fDAUN-0007m5-BU for guile-user@gnu.org; Mon, 30 Apr 2018 11:13:15 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1525101194; bh=Ddsf9/XqmkGEn7d58uRlWaME+Azfalzq90+o/II9U/w=; h=From:Date:To:Subject:From:Subject; b=D4wiTNcC09CI9xxqjOQ5guUb/3ODb42MsnEIijVzT9vTj4nwRxOD0nBLHm1XjgFuv+vR7qr8Y3n+FXl9al0jggSB/V/jYuaF1HzNSRxPKI+pVxFOC7bwxA27benIU2yIekimdd3JurwzqXXigbI4KU5BROfmmZTMw0ENcYAAa4TSm+waRxyxU4tKW2VDZCB8fEjfe/dFjiF2f1aJKxbuPgnbrF9E+edbLvVLyLlcPdXFNCtHHOqygkn2XIJohOc7qIMsyWJG3s+NHPPihovE3UJTHWA3eAsLf+hEXtHjfx8U5whgwhwjSKyOjrOaSIgdeikBTa9LqxzeRnMAS+hbQg== X-YMail-OSG: fNHKf7IVM1ncH9_ukf4neiSltid7_sfWYbaYtILX3tdcirau4c1ZVv5QgjRlyG6 7VhJcRV.MBKJz2LYCxKaH2N9HUEmBSeLPxrchI5GkP0cOAQGu5zZkijxODt1PXv_SPAE7DweWXzm Z7PWw43aUD71KkoPprAKiGzvlsLB41pPML3ez9kyjXE_WUfSwB.NNcV89Odvui.gR.bkDeQyxJbg RFDEnW7GvZrgeIthUpNFZue48yUEl6B6hPv3RzuLG7Z.vdXsQtVncA66sWCf8ViQMvuia_AI2NAM yqkPqvsjrApkZAh_I_KOu0jhbZBx0ZHe7_sYeN5mlqU8hb.ABVPGTPF7qogUiCZ7fvnThwo.0q3N 9AtNqBwtFVvKiRv4TdUcyDnS0P9EqpKRewZAQPbo.1EOqNArWHrl7jSlq2UMS8G0nD.9sQ5b.kbe et7Zyy8V0Dnu1tAc2gNx9rGvUmInmjvMrvVfNbvowYaT2zgSVV39bDv4VCopL9uhzOe61.g_2DkV BUc9915ByaHjSjgoOYbgmKxt.sXxxxwcDZkeM7MWYI4myJ0rkCyYR8AW.L.OpV7Q13ijPzTeUIDI iYTHXvIS6EGBTNiRpXgE9RKADPdld8Mf4Jrnx9XnJ14rDilIqiYYBTyOVkN1bePNaKBo6B73WyO7 s0jV8zIBTmmxKaexWbsrotTGYT6dpjA-- Original-Received: from sonic.gate.mail.ne1.yahoo.com by sonic301.consmr.mail.bf2.yahoo.com with HTTP; Mon, 30 Apr 2018 15:13:14 +0000 Original-Received: from 162-197-224-133.lightspeed.irvnca.sbcglobal.net (EHLO joshua.spikycactus.dnsalias.com) ([162.197.224.133]) by smtp424.mail.bf1.yahoo.com (Oath Hermes SMTP Server) with ESMTPA ID c30c5f72d7b833d1c1be2bb6d981ba18 for ; Mon, 30 Apr 2018 15:13:10 +0000 (UTC) Original-Received: by joshua.spikycactus.dnsalias.com (sSMTP sendmail emulation); Mon, 30 Apr 2018 08:13:09 -0700 Content-Disposition: inline X-detected-operating-system: by eggs.gnu.org: GNU/Linux 3.x [fuzzy] X-Received-From: 74.6.129.42 X-BeenThere: guile-user@gnu.org X-Mailman-Version: 2.1.21 Precedence: list List-Id: General Guile related disc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guile-user-bounces+guile-user=m.gmane.org@gnu.org Original-Sender: "guile-user" Xref: news.gmane.org gmane.lisp.guile.user:14548 Archived-At: Hey y'all, So there was this 10-day game jam for Lisp-like languages, and I put together a trifling piece of interactive fiction based on an 1911 play by William S Houghton. The program itself is mostly the GTK3 toolkit for the GUI and Guile for the scripting. Keeping in mind that I wrote this in just a few days, you might find it somewhat humourous to check out. The game takes about 10 minutes to play through. It has not been widely tested across platforms. There are Windows and GNU/Linux binaries at https://spk121.itch.io/fancy-free And the source is at https://github.com/spk121/burro The build script used to make the downloadable builds at https://github.com/spk121/psychic-guacamole For MinGW, this requires a patched version of Guile branched off of 2.2.3 http://git.savannah.gnu.org/cgit/guile.git/log/?=wip-mingw-guile-2.2 Regards, Mike Gran